Major Components of Energy Infrastructure Projects
Energy infrastructure projects encompass several critical components that collectively enable the safe and efficient delivery of energy. These components include generation facilities, transmission infrastructure, distribution networks, and supporting systems such as control and communication systems. Each component requires careful legal and technical consideration during project development.
Generation facilities form the heart of any energy infrastructure project, including power plants for electricity or energy extraction sites for oil and gas. The legal framework governing these facilities addresses permits, environmental compliance, and land use rights. The transmission infrastructure involves high-voltage lines and substations necessary for moving energy from generation points to consumer regions. Legal arrangements for cross-border interconnections and right-of-way acquisitions are essential here.
Distribution networks facilitate the delivery of energy from transmission system points to end-users, including residential, commercial, and industrial consumers. This component often involves local permits and licensing, governed by legal standards ensuring safety and reliability. Supporting systems such as control centers and communication networks are crucial for monitoring and managing energy flow, with legal compliance focused on cybersecurity and operational standards.
Overall, these components are interconnected, forming a comprehensive legal and infrastructural framework that underpins the development and operation of energy infrastructure projects globally.

Land Acquisition and Rights of Way
Land acquisition and rights of way are fundamental aspects of energy infrastructure law, as they determine access to land necessary for project development. Securing these rights involves navigating complex legal frameworks that balance infrastructure needs with property owners’ rights.
Legal processes vary by jurisdiction but typically include negotiations, eminent domain proceedings, and compensation agreements. These processes aim to ensure fair treatment for landowners while facilitating timely project implementation.
Environmental and community considerations often influence land acquisition strategies. Developers must comply with environmental laws and often engage in public consultations, which can impact the acquisition timeline. Transparency and adherence to legal standards are critical.
Effective management of rights of way is essential for minimizing delays and legal disputes, which can significantly impact project costs and schedules. Legal clarity and proactive negotiations help uphold energy infrastructure law’s objective of enabling efficient energy project deployment.
Legal Processes for Project Approvals and Licensing
Legal processes for project approvals and licensing in energy infrastructure law involve a series of steps designed to ensure compliance with applicable regulations and standards. These procedures typically begin with detailed application submissions to relevant government agencies, including environmental, safety, and land use authorities. Agencies review these applications to verify adherence to statutory requirements and assess potential environmental and social impacts.
Following submission, public consultations and stakeholder engagements are often mandated to address community concerns and gather input. The approval process may also require obtaining permits related to environmental compliance, land use, construction, and operational safety. Each permit is subject to specific review periods and conditions that project developers must satisfy to proceed.
Finally, once all legal and regulatory criteria are met, project licenses are issued, enabling the energy infrastructure project to commence construction and operation phases. These legal processes are vital to balancing project development with environmental protection, land rights, and public interests, thereby ensuring sustainable and lawful energy infrastructure development.

Interconnection Agreements
Interconnection agreements are legal contracts that establish the terms and conditions for connecting new energy infrastructure to existing networks. They ensure that power systems operate safely, reliably, and efficiently within the broader energy market.
These agreements define technical specifications, operational responsibilities, and maintenance requirements for both parties involved. They are essential for facilitating seamless energy transfer across borders or regional grids, supporting energy trade and market integration.
Legal frameworks governing interconnection agreements vary by jurisdiction but generally emphasize fairness, transparency, and compliance with regulatory standards. They also address dispute resolution mechanisms to manage any operational conflicts.
Overall, interconnection agreements play a vital role in supporting energy infrastructure development, fostering cooperation between stakeholders, and ensuring the robustness of energy transmission systems. Their legal clarity is crucial for promoting investment and enhancing energy security.
